Whitening Teeth with Charcoal
This is a very common; but expensive, practise.
Charcoal is used as a poison absorber. Activated charcoal is swallowed to absorb specific poisons ingested by a person. It is available in capsules. That is why it whitens teeth. It absorbs coatings.
